This is a 19th century, finely carved Celadon/Green Jade Snuff Bottle, carved in the form of a Jar with Peach branch surrounding it. The peach branch has several fruit hanging from it as well as a bird resting on it. It is a mostly of natural celadon color ground with some green skin that has been carved as peaches on one of the sides of the bottle. It comes with a celadon jade stopper. This great looking bottle is in excellent preserved condition. Bottle Measurements Height: 1.71 inches (4.3cm) - not including stopper Width: 1.77 inches (4.5cm) Thickness: 0.89 inches (2.2cm) Weight: 2.3 ounces Similar form snuff bottles are illustrated in 'The Collector's Book of Snuff Bottles
